Essential Skills for RPA Success in Accounting
To excel in RPA, accounting professionals need to develop a unique blend of technical, business, and soft skills. Some of the essential skills required for success in this field include:
Technical skills: Proficiency in RPA software, such as UiPath, Automation Anywhere, or Blue Prism, is critical for designing, implementing, and managing automated accounting processes.
Accounting knowledge: A deep understanding of accounting principles, financial regulations, and industry-specific requirements is necessary for identifying automation opportunities and ensuring compliance.
Analytical skills: The ability to analyze complex accounting processes, identify bottlenecks, and optimize workflows is crucial for maximizing the benefits of RPA.
Communication skills: Effective communication with stakeholders, including accountants, auditors, and business leaders, is vital for ensuring smooth implementation and adoption of RPA solutions.
Best Practices for Implementing RPA in Accounting
When implementing RPA in accounting, it's essential to follow best practices that ensure successful adoption and maximize returns on investment. Some of the key best practices include:
Start small: Begin with simple, high-impact processes, such as accounts payable or accounts receivable, to build momentum and confidence.
Collaborate with stakeholders: Engage with accountants, auditors, and business leaders to ensure that RPA solutions meet their needs and expectations.
Monitor and evaluate: Continuously monitor and evaluate RPA performance to identify areas for improvement and optimize workflows.
Develop a Center of Excellence: Establish a dedicated RPA team or center of excellence to provide governance, support, and training for RPA initiatives.
Career Opportunities in RPA for Accounting Professionals
A Postgraduate Certificate in Robotic Process Automation can open up exciting career opportunities for accounting professionals. Some of the potential career paths include:
RPA Consultant: Work with organizations to design and implement RPA solutions that improve accounting efficiency and reduce costs.
Accounting Automation Specialist: Lead the development and implementation of RPA solutions within an organization's accounting function.
Financial Process Improvement Manager: Oversee the design and implementation of process improvements that leverage RPA and other technologies.
Digital Transformation Manager: Lead organizational-wide digital transformation initiatives that include RPA and other emerging technologies.
